    First time in Charleston or South Carolina. Came here on a business trip with a group of colleagues and we all started in different hotels Don't ask why... we just did... and I think Ingot the BEST of the lot. The staff was hospitable from the get go! From check in to turn down service to checkout. There is a great view of the river, with tons of boats moored/parked just out side the back courtyard. There is a decent pool, weight room (I should have used it more with all this delicious food this town offers), a bistro cafe and a bar. My room was comfortable. The king bed was very comfy. The view I had was great overlooking the pool and the water. I'd recommend this place for any occasion from vacationing to business.... Close to the Historic Downtown district and the Market. You do have to pay nightly for the parking garage (which came out to $8 a night), or you can park in one of two of their outdoor lots. Whether pleasure or business, as always... Enjoy and Happy Sight Seeing!

    This is an older Marriott that needs a little TLC. The views are spectacular, the lobby and bar area are updated and really fun. The outside area is beautiful. The thing with an older Marriott you may hear your neighbors and it might not be as shiny as new ones, but the locations are almost always a win. And the beds are good and you NEVER have to worry about hot water or water pressure. Spring for the room with a water view. Maybe not the balcony, bc it isn't big enough to sit on, but nice to open the door and watch the sunset. The lobby is a great place to work if you need to get out of the room for a bit or if late check out it not an option. The staff is super friendly and the coffee down stairs is very good.

    It's Marriott, so it has the typical Marriott look and feel - with a comfy off-lobby lounge area -,with a view. It's on the water, so there are some nice views. Request a water view when booking your reservation. It''s adjacent to the hospital district, but waking to the hospitals looked like it would not be optimal because of the layout of the roads. It's just a 10 minute drive to historic downtown Charleston and some of the best restaurants anywhere. I didn't see any restaurants in walking distance, so everything will be a drive. Again, it's Marriott, so it has the typical Marriott look and feel. Other data points: -Good parking with some covered -Lobby on the second floor -Coffee, drinks, and minimal food options -Covid sensitive
